Flyers' Andrej Meszaros has surgery, out indefinitely

Flyers defenseman Andrej Meszaros is out indefinitely after having surgery to repair a torn right Achilles tendon, the team announced Tuesday.

Meszaros suffered the injury during a training session in Slovakia last week, according to Flyers GM Paul Holmgren. The surgery was performed Tuesday morning at Jefferson Hospital in Philadelphia.

The loss of Meszaros is a big hit to a Flyers team which was already short on quality defensemen.

Meszaros was plus-6 for the Flyers last season and tallied seven goals and 18 assists.
